Amazon Sr. Learning Manager, GSF L&D in Bangalore, India

Description

The Sr. Learning Manager will lead the coordination and execution of UFF, SSD Associate training, LM DA Training, Hybird Picker Training and Ops leadership onboarding/development activities.

Successful candidates will have demonstrated a true hands-on approach, a data-driven, analytical mindset, an understanding of training plan design and effectiveness measurement, and knowledge of Logistics/ distribution operations. Ability to influence without authority and effective presentation & persuasion skills are a must as this role.

Sr. Learning Manager will:

· Implement network standard training programs for associates, managers, trainers and others (i.e., participating in and conducting needs analysis, skills development classes, cross-training, manager technical training, etc.)

· Manage Area Trainer’s deployment, development and productivity

· Partner with operations leaders across all areas to identify training needs and schedule training events to meet production forecasts and labor gaps

· Act as a proactive and productive liaison/partner with internal customers and the Operations team by consistently seeking to make a positive impact on key business safety, quality, productivity and customer experience metrics

· Manage and customize training content to meet regional needs and track compliance to these training materials

· Analyze and understand data to suggest improvements for training and operations

· Drive a continuous improvement culture by coordinating and facilitating activities in partnership with operations leaders
